How To Grow Cilantro From Seed: A Complete Botanical & Harvesting Guide
Growing cilantro (Coriandrum sativum) successfully from seed requires cool soil temperatures between 55°F and 68°F (13°C–20°C), well-draining soil with a pH of 6.2 to 6.8, and direct sowing to protect the plant's fragile taproot. Cracking the hard outer seed husk (schizocarp) prior to planting at a depth of 1/4 to 1/2 inch accelerates germination to within 7 to 10 days. Implementing a succession planting schedule every 14 to 21 days provides a continuous harvest of fresh foliage while preventing heat-induced premature bolting.
Pre-Planting Preparation & Material Requirements
Cilantro is a cool-season annual herb belonging to the Apiaceae family. Unlike soft-stemmed herbs that transplant easily, Coriandrum sativum develops a prominent taproot system that reacts to transplant stress by instantly triggering premature flowering (bolting). Successful establishment depends on direct-sowing into high-quality, well-draining soil matrices and managing ambient environmental stressors.
Essential Materials Checklist
- Primary Cultivation Seeds: Non-treated, high-germination cilantro seeds (select bolt-resistant cultivars such as 'Calypso', 'Cruiser', or 'Santro' for warm climates).
- Soil Amendments: Aged compost, coarse horticultural sand or perlite, and organic broad-spectrum slow-release fertilizer (low nitrogen ratio, e.g., 3-4-4).
- Tools & Equipment: Hand cultivator, mechanical seed-cracking roller (or flat wooden board), fine-mist irrigation nozzle, soil pH test kit, and 50% shade cloth (optional for warm-climate installations).
- Containers (If Applicable): Deep pots or planter boxes with minimum dimensions of 8 to 12 inches in depth to accommodate unrestricted taproot extension.
Prerequisite Environmental Standards
- Soil Temperature Window: 55°F to 68°F (13°C to 20°C) for optimal seed emergence. Thermal dormancy occurs above 75°F (24°C).
- Solar Exposure: 6 hours of direct morning sunlight daily. Partial afternoon shade is mandatory in USDA Hardiness Zones 7 and higher.
- Target Soil pH: 6.2 to 6.8 (slightly acidic to neutral).
Operational Resource Benchmarks
- Financial Investment: $10 – $30 for seeds, soil conditioners, and baseline tools.
- Germination Window: 7 to 14 days (reduced to 5 to 7 days with pre-planting seed prep).
- Time to Harvest: 40 to 50 days for leaf harvest; 90 to 100 days for coriander seed harvest.
Step-by-Step Cilantro Cultivation Workflow
Step 1: Seed Preparation and Schizocarp Conditioning
Cilantro seeds are not single seeds; they are dry, hard fruits called schizocarps, each containing two distinct seeds encapsulated inside a woody outer husk. Planting the husk intact results in delayed germination and multiple seedlings competing within a tight space.
- Place the dry seeds on a flat, clean surface such as a cutting board.
- Apply gentle down-and-forward pressure with a wooden rolling pin or flat board. The goal is to crack the outer husk open without crushing the fragile internal embryonic seeds inside.
- Submerge the cracked seeds in room-temperature (68°F/20°C) non-chlorinated water for 12 to 24 hours. This hydrates the seed coat and washes away natural germination inhibitors.
- Strain the seeds through a fine mesh filter and spread them on paper towels to air-dry slightly before sowing so they do not clump together.
Pro-Tip: Pre-soaking cracked seed husks speeds up field emergence by up to 50% and improves uniform stand density across cultivation rows.
Step 2: Soil Matrix Preparation and Bed Conditioning
Cilantro thrives in rich, friable loam with excellent internal drainage. Compacted clay soils retain excessive water, promoting root decay and taproot stunting.
- Clear the planting site of all weeds, debris, and stones down to a depth of 10 inches.
- Till 2 to 3 inches of fully decomposed organic matter (compost or leaf mold) into the top 6 inches of native soil.
- If growing in heavy clay, incorporate coarse sand or perlite at a volume ratio of 1:4 to elevate soil porosity.
- Rake the bed level, breaking apart soil clods larger than a marble to create a fine, uniform seedbed texture.
- Check soil pH. Incorporate agricultural lime to raise pH if below 6.0, or elemental sulfur to lower pH if above 7.2.
Step 3: Precision Direct Sowing Procedure
Because cilantro root systems are highly sensitive to physical disruption, direct sowing into permanent garden beds or final containers is mandatory for optimal crop yield.
- Mark planting rows spaced 12 inches apart using a chalk line or wooden guide.
- Create shallow seed furrows 1/4 to 1/2 inch (6 to 12 mm) deep using a hand dibber or the handle of a garden trowel. Do not sow deeper than 1/2 inch, as seeds lack the reserve energy to push through heavy soil cover.
- Sow the conditioned seeds along the furrows at a rate of 1 to 2 seeds per inch.
- Cover the seeds loosely with fine soil or screened compost. Gently tamp the surface with the palm of your hand to ensure complete seed-to-soil contact.
- Water the area thoroughly using a misting nozzle setting to saturate the top 2 inches of soil without washing away the shallowly planted seeds.
Warning: Avoid applying high-nitrogen fertilizers at planting time. Excessive nitrogen causes weak, elongated stems with low essential oil concentration, compromising flavor and physical stability.
Step 4: Moisture Management and Seedling Thinning
Maintaining consistent soil moisture is crucial during the initial 14-day germination and seedling establishment phase.
- Irrigate the seedbed daily with a gentle spray to keep the top layer of soil evenly moist, but never waterlogged.
- Once seedlings emerge and develop their first set of true leaves (which feature the classic fan-shaped serrated leaf design), thin the stand.
- Thin the seedlings to a final spacing of 4 to 6 inches (10 to 15 cm) apart by cutting unwanted seedlings at the soil surface using clean micro-tip pruning snips.
- Do not pull unwanted seedlings out by the roots; doing so damages the delicate taproots of adjacent plants you intend to keep.
Step 5: Succession Planting and Microclimate Control
Cilantro is biologically wired to flower and produce seed (bolt) as day lengths cross 12 hours and ambient temperatures exceed 75°F (24°C).
- Execute succession sowings every 14 to 21 days from early spring until early summer, and resume in late summer for a fall crop.
- When daytime temperatures consistently top 70°F (21°C), install a 50% shade cloth structure suspended 18 inches above the crop canopy to filter afternoon sunlight.
- Apply a 1- to 2-inch layer of organic mulch (shredded bark or clean straw) around established seedlings to cool the root zone and conserve soil moisture.
Step 6: Harvesting Protocol for Leaves and Seeds
harvesting correctly extends leaf production and yields high-quality spice seeds at the end of the lifecycle.
- Leaf Harvest (Cilantro): Begin harvesting when plants reach 6 inches in height (typically 40 to 45 days after sowing). Snip individual outer leaves near the base of the stem, leaving the central crown intact for continuous regrowth.
- Cut-and-Come-Again Method: Cut the entire foliage layer 1 to 2 inches above soil level. The plant will produce secondary flushes of growth if the growing point remains undamaged and temperatures stay cool.
- Seed Harvest (Coriander): When the plant eventually bolts and sets flowers, allow the umbrella-like blooms to attract beneficial pollinators. Wait for the green seed clusters to turn light brown and dry on the stem (around day 90 to 100).
- Cut whole seed heads, place them upside down inside paper bags, and store them in a dry, ventilated room for 10 days until seeds drop freely from the stems.

Cultivars & Growth Specs
Selecting the appropriate cultivar based on your regional climate, seasonal window, and intended use is critical to success. The following matrix details performance parameters for major cilantro cultivars:
| Cultivar | Days to Emergence | Days to Harvest (Foliage) | Heat Tolerance Index | Recommended Plant Spacing | Primary Architectural Trait |
|---|---|---|---|---|---|
| Calypso | 7 – 10 Days | 50 – 55 Days | Very High | 4 – 6 inches | Industry standard for bolt resistance; slow to flower. |
| Santo | 8 – 12 Days | 45 – 50 Days | Moderate | 4 – 5 inches | High-yielding, erect growth pattern; easy to harvest. |
| Leisure | 10 – 14 Days | 40 – 45 Days | High | 6 inches | Excellent heat resistance; heavy leaf canopy mass. |
| Cruiser | 7 – 10 Days | 45 – 50 Days | High | 4 – 6 inches | Compact architecture with sturdy, thick stem structures. |
| Confetti | 8 – 10 Days | 35 – 40 Days | Low to Moderate | 3 – 4 inches | Finely cut, fern-like leaves; sweet flavor profile. |
| Monogerm | 6 – 9 Days | 40 – 48 Days | Moderate | 4 – 5 inches | Single-seeded husk; eliminates step to crack outer husk. |
Troubleshooting Common Field & Container Failures
Issue 1: Rapid Bolting and Premature Flowering
- Root Cause: Thermal stress (ambient temperatures sustained above 75°F/24°C), root disturbance caused by transplanting, or severe soil moisture fluctuations triggering an emergency reproduction response.
- Actionable Fix: Shift planting windows strictly to cool seasons (early spring/early autumn). Direct-sow seeds rather than using nursery plugs. Maintain consistent soil moisture, mulch the soil surface to insulate roots, and erect a 50% shade cloth overlay during unexpected heat spikes.
Issue 2: Seedling Damping Off (Stem Collapse at Ground Level)
- Root Cause: Soil-borne fungal pathogens (Pythium, Rhizoctonia, or Fusarium spp.) fueled by overwatering, dense sowing, poor air circulation, and poorly draining soil.
- Actionable Fix: Use sterilized growing media for containers or solarized, high-drainage soil in ground beds. Thin seedlings immediately to a minimum 4-inch spacing to promote healthy air movement. Allow the soil surface to dry slightly between watering cycles.
Issue 3: Foliar Chlorosis (Yellowing of Lower Leaves)
- Root Cause: Nitrogen deficiency caused by leaching in light soils, or root hypoxia (suffocation) from saturated, waterlogged soil conditions.
- Actionable Fix: Verify that the planting bed or container drains water freely within 15 minutes of heavy irrigation. If drainage is adequate, apply a balanced organic liquid fertilizer (such as liquid kelp combined with fish hydrolysate diluted to half-strength) every 14 days.
Issue 4: Erratic or Low Germination Rates
- Root Cause: Planting intact seed husks without pre-cracking/soaking, planting seeds deeper than 1/2 inch, or elevated soil temperatures (>80°F/27°C) causing thermal seed dormancy.
- Actionable Fix: Gently roll seeds prior to sowing to crack outer shells, pre-soak seeds in room-temperature water for 12 hours, and ensure seeds are sown no deeper than 1/4 to 1/2 inch. Monitor soil temperatures with a probe before planting.
Frequently Asked Questions
Can you grow cilantro indoors from seed year-round?
Yes, cilantro can be grown indoors year-round if provided with adequate light and pot depth. Use a container at least 8 to 12 inches deep with bottom drainage holes, and place it under a full-spectrum LED grow light for 12 to 14 hours per day, keeping room temperatures between 60°F and 70°F.
Should you soak cilantro seeds before planting?
Soaking cilantro seeds is not strictly mandatory, but it significantly accelerates germination. Cracking the outer husk and soaking seeds in room-temperature water for 12 to 24 hours reduces germination time from up to two weeks down to 5 to 7 days.
Why does my cilantro taste soapy?
A soapy taste in cilantro foliage is primarily genetic rather than a cultural issue. Certain people possess a variation in a cluster of olfactory receptor genes (specifically OR6A2) that makes them highly sensitive to the aldehydes present in cilantro essential oils, causing it to taste like soap.
How often should I water cilantro seedlings?
Water cilantro seedlings whenever the top 1/2 inch of soil feels dry to the touch, typically every 1 to 3 days depending on climate and humidity. Maintain steady soil moisture without creating muddy, waterlogged conditions that encourage root rot.
Will cilantro regrow after you cut it?
Cilantro will regrow if harvested correctly using the cut-and-come-again method. Trim the outer leaves 1 to 2 inches above the soil level, taking care not to damage the central growing node (crown) or remove more than one-third of the plant's total foliage at one time.
